Predictive Value of 99mTc- Albumin Spheres Before 90Y- SIR Therapy

Summary

The purpose of this study is to assess the predictive value of 99mTechnetium (Tc)- labeled albumin in macroaggregates (MAA) and in microspheres (B20) injected into the common hepatic artery for the distribution of 90Yttrium- Selective Internal Radiotherapy (SIRT)-spheres (SIR- spheres).

Interventions

DRUG

MAA for diagnostic SPECT imaging

Intraarterial application of 5ml containing 500.000 particles with an activity of 150MBq.

DRUG

Diagnostic B20- SPECT imaging.

Intraarterial application of 5ml containing 150.000 particles with an activity of 150 MBq.
